Analog Devices Inc. ADA4177-4ARZ-R7 Precision Op-Amp
The ADA4177-4ARZ-R7 is a state-of-the-art precision operational amplifier (op-amp) from Analog Devices Inc., designed to meet the rigorous requirements of modern electronic applications. This high-performance component is engineered to provide exceptional accuracy and stability, making it an ideal choice for precision instrumentation, control systems, and analog signal processing tasks.
With its low input bias current, low offset voltage, and low noise, the ADA4177-4ARZ-R7 ensures a minimal impact on signal fidelity, translating to clean and precise amplification. The device operates over a wide supply range, accommodating single-supply voltages from 4.5V to 36V, or dual supplies of ±2.25V to ±18V. This flexibility makes it suitable for a variety of operating environments and compatible with a broad spectrum of other electronic components.
One of the key features of the ADA4177-4ARZ-R7 is its robustness against harsh conditions. It is designed with Analog Devices Inc.'s proprietary iCMOS industrial process, which gives it an excellent over-the-top capability, allowing the op-amp to handle inputs beyond the power supply rails without phase reversal. This characteristic is particularly beneficial in situations where input signals may occasionally exceed normal operating levels.
The ADA4177-4ARZ-R7 also boasts a high output drive capability and includes overvoltage protection up to 32V for both input and output, which safeguards the device against momentary voltage spikes. The op-amp's circuitry is encapsulated in a compact 14-lead SOIC (Small Outline Integrated Circuit) package, ensuring a minimal footprint on circuit boards and ease of integration into a wide array of electronic systems.
